summaryrefslogtreecommitdiffstats
path: root/block
Commit message (Expand)AuthorAgeFilesLines
* blk-mq: don't allow queue entering for a dying queueKeith Busch2014-06-061-2/+4
* blk-mq: bump max tag depth to 10K tagsJens Axboe2014-06-061-1/+12
* block: add blk_rq_set_block_pc()Jens Axboe2014-06-063-4/+23
* block: add notion of a chunk size for request mergingJens Axboe2014-06-052-1/+20
* block: mq flush: clear flush_rq's tag in flush_end_io()Ming Lei2014-06-041-1/+1
* blk-mq: let blk_mq_tag_to_rq() take blk_mq_tags as the main parameterJens Axboe2014-06-041-7/+12
* blk-mq: fix regression from commit 624dbe475416Jens Axboe2014-06-041-0/+2
* blk-mq: handle NULL req return from blk_map_request in single queue modeJens Axboe2014-06-041-0/+2
* blk-mq: fix sparse warning on missed __percpu annotationMing Lei2014-06-041-1/+1
* blk-mq: fix schedule from atomic contextMing Lei2014-06-044-31/+78
* blk-mq: move blk_mq_get_ctx/blk_mq_put_ctx to mq private headerMing Lei2014-06-042-22/+22
* Merge branch 'locking-core-for-linus' of git://git.kernel.org/pub/scm/linux/k...Linus Torvalds2014-06-031-2/+2
|\
| * arch: Mass conversion of smp_mb__*()Peter Zijlstra2014-04-181-2/+2
* | Merge branch 'for-3.16/drivers' of git://git.kernel.dk/linux-block into nextLinus Torvalds2014-06-021-1/+1
|\ \
| * \ Merge branch 'for-3.16/core' into for-3.16/driversJens Axboe2014-05-305-37/+45
| |\ \
| * \ \ Merge branch 'for-3.16/core' into for-3.16/driversJens Axboe2014-05-284-21/+33
| |\ \ \
| * \ \ \ Merge branch 'for-3.16/core' into for-3.16/driversJens Axboe2014-05-2821-495/+4631
| |\ \ \ \
| * | | | | bsg: update check for rq based driver for blk-mqJens Axboe2014-04-161-1/+1
* | | | | | Merge branch 'for-3.16/core' of git://git.kernel.dk/linux-block into nextLinus Torvalds2014-06-0224-756/+5083
|\ \ \ \ \ \
| * | | | | | blk-mq: push IPI or local end_io decision to __blk_mq_complete_request()Jens Axboe2014-05-311-7/+13
| * | | | | | blk-mq: remember to start timeout handler for direct queueJens Axboe2014-05-301-0/+1
| * | | | | | block: ensure that the timer is always addedJens Axboe2014-05-301-1/+1
| * | | | | | blk-mq: blk_mq_unregister_hctx() can be staticFengguang Wu2014-05-301-2/+2
| * | | | | | blk-mq: make the sysfs mq/ layout reflect current mappingsJens Axboe2014-05-303-19/+93
| | |_|_|/ / | |/| | | |
| * | | | | blk-mq: blk_mq_tag_to_rq should handle flush requestShaohua Li2014-05-302-4/+12
| * | | | | block: remove dead code in scsi_ioctl:blk_verify_commandDave Jones2014-05-291-4/+0Star
| * | | | | blk-mq: request initialization optimizationsJens Axboe2014-05-291-17/+9Star
| * | | | | block: add queue flag for disabling SG mergingJens Axboe2014-05-292-7/+24
| * | | | | block: remove 'magic' from struct blk_plugJens Axboe2014-05-291-5/+0Star
| | |_|/ / | |/| | |
| * | | | blk-mq: remove alloc_hctx and free_hctx methodsChristoph Hellwig2014-05-281-21/+5Star
| * | | | blk-mq: add file comments and update copyright noticesJens Axboe2014-05-284-0/+28
| | |/ / | |/| |
| * | | blk-mq: remove blk_mq_alloc_request_pinnedChristoph Hellwig2014-05-281-32/+16Star
| * | | blk-mq: do not use blk_mq_alloc_request_pinned in blk_mq_map_requestChristoph Hellwig2014-05-281-3/+5
| * | | blk-mq: remove blk_mq_wait_for_tagsChristoph Hellwig2014-05-283-16/+6Star
| * | | blk-mq: initialize request in __blk_mq_alloc_requestChristoph Hellwig2014-05-281-32/+30Star
| * | | blk-mq: merge blk_mq_alloc_reserved_request into blk_mq_alloc_requestChristoph Hellwig2014-05-282-18/+4Star
| * | | blk-mq: add helper to insert requests from irq contextChristoph Hellwig2014-05-282-13/+67
| * | | blk-mq: allow non-softirq completionsJens Axboe2014-05-281-3/+9
| * | | blk-mq: pass in suggested NUMA node to ->alloc_hctx()Jens Axboe2014-05-273-11/+32
| * | | block: only allocate/free mq_usage_counter in blk-mqMing Lei2014-05-273-8/+6Star
| * | | blk-mq: avoid code duplicationMing Lei2014-05-271-24/+37
| * | | blk-mq: fix leak of hctx->ctx_mapMing Lei2014-05-271-0/+1
| * | | block/blk-lib.c: make __blkdev_issue_zeroout staticFabian Frederick2014-05-271-2/+2
| * | | blk-mq: idle all hardware contexts before freeing a queueChristoph Hellwig2014-05-271-0/+1
| * | | blk-mq: allow setting of per-request timeoutsJens Axboe2014-05-231-2/+6
| * | | blk-mq: export blk_mq_tag_busy_iterSam Bradshaw2014-05-232-1/+1
| * | | blk-mq: split make request handler for multi and single queueJens Axboe2014-05-221-50/+157
| * | | blk-mq: save memory by freeing requests on unused hardware queuesJens Axboe2014-05-211-52/+105
| * | | blk-mq: allow the hctx cpu hotplug notifier to return errorsJens Axboe2014-05-213-9/+14
| * | | blk-mq: Micro-optimize blk_queue_nomerges() checkRobert Elliott2014-05-202-5/+6